Since my last Journal entry, only one thing has really changed. I completed a class this semester and I am proud of myself because I have one thing down and it felt good to accomplish that. I had my final IEP(Individualized Education Plan). Anc Individualized Education Plan means I receive services and support from special education group. People that were in my IEP meeting were my mom, Mr. Arroyo, Mr. Gonzales, and Ms.Rashelle. I felt nervous during the meeting because I thought Mr. Arroyo was going to say negative things about me and make my mom worried and concerned but when we were at the meeting Mr. Arroyo said good things about me.
My mom and I talked about being in CPS for my career. Two reason why I want to be a CPS is because I want to help the children that don’t feel safe in their homes or their parents abuses them. My other reason is because my mom wants me to follow my dreams and make my family proud and help the children.
My first semester has been very stressful even though I thought it was going to be less work. I was wrong about that. Now that I am a senior it is very hard and they give you two days to work on it and turn it in. Also you have lots, I mean lots, of homework. There isn’t one day without homework unless you are on pace in all your classes. I think this semester I am doing good because of the I get help from my Special ED teachers.
What I need to accomplish before the semester ends is being on pace in my classes. I am behind in Algebra 1, U.S history, and Science. I need to start working harder and staying after school for help. If I ask for help I can be on pace and I don’t have to worry about being behind.
My senior project has been kind of hard to do because a lot of the questions I have to answer. I haven’t thought of some of the things it has asked.This has made me think harder about my future. The project is keeping me organized and preparing me for when I graduate. It will be fun to look back on this project and see what my plans were and if I accomplish my goals.
